Abstract
A monosubstituted polyacetylene having amine functional groups was prepared via the polymerization of 3-ethynylaniline by using transition metal catalysts. The polymerization proceeded well in homogeneous manner to give a relatively high yield of polymer. The polymer structure was characterized by such instrumental methods as IR, NMR, and UV-visible spectroscopies to have the conjugated backbone system with the designed functional groups. The absorption spectrum starts around 700 nm, which is due to the π→ π* interband transition of conjugated polymer system. This polymer exhibited the irreversible electrochemical behaviors between the doping and undoping peaks.
